Dr. A. Antler is a leading researcher in precision livestock farming, with a primary focus on dairy cattle health monitoring and automated detection systems. Their work centers on integrating sensor data—including rumination, activity, milk yield, and body weight—to develop decision-support tools for early disease identification in robotic-milking operations. A landmark contribution is their 2016 study, cited 49 times, which introduced a decision-tree model capable of detecting post-calving diseases without disrupting herd routines. This approach enables farmers to isolate sick cows proactively, minimizing stress on both animals and automated systems. Dr. Antler’s earlier work on computer vision, including a 2013 paper with 30 citations on cow contour extraction algorithms, laid foundational methods for non-invasive health monitoring. By combining behavioral analytics with machine learning, their research has significantly advanced the practicality of precision dairy farming, offering scalable solutions that improve animal welfare and farm efficiency. Their contributions are particularly valued in the transition toward fully automated, sensor-rich agricultural environments.
